Output dddf77d6babed4edd8a5d7ecab90eb12c5497499ebf7013e00dab8a26a32b5be:1

value
65210552
script pubkey
OP_0 OP_PUSHBYTES_20 78e1fe50b7cd0d13cb992ce4d218142a552442f3
address
bc1q0rslu59he5x38jue9njdyxq59f2jgshnsex47u
transaction
dddf77d6babed4edd8a5d7ecab90eb12c5497499ebf7013e00dab8a26a32b5be
confirmations
109089
spent
true